The 18th intercalibration of invertebrates in the ICP Waters programme had contribution from three laboratories. The laboratories identified a very high portion of the individuals in the test samples, > 95% of the total number of species. On the genus level, few faults were recorded. The mean Quality assurance index ranged between 96.0 and 97.1, well above the value 80 - indicating very good taxonomic work.
